WebAssigning Permissions with ESXCLI. You can use ESXCLI commands to manage permissions. Starting with vSphere 6.0, a set of ESXCLI commands allows you to perform the following operations. Give permissions to local users and groups by assigning them one of the predefined roles. WebFeb 29, 2016 · Through the Vsphere Client. Open the Esxi in Vsphere client with Admin privilege. Then in left side click on the "Host Name/IP" Then in the right select the "Local Users & Groups". Right click on the user and choose Edit option you will get a window to edit the user credentials.
